HAZARD
RISK OF HOT SURFACES
WHAT CAN HAPPEN HOW TO PREVENT IT
• Touchingexposedmetalsuch
as the compressor head, engine
head, engine exhaust or outlet
tubes, can result in serious burns.
• Nevertouchanyexposedmetal
parts on compressor during or
immediately after operation.
Compressorwillremainhotfor
several minutes after operation.
• Donotreacharoundprotective
shrouds or attempt maintenance
until unit has been allowed to cool.
HAZARD
RISK FROM MOVING PARTS
WHAT CAN HAPPEN HOW TO PREVENT IT
• Movingpartssuchasthepulley,
flywheel, and belt can cause
seriousinjuryiftheycomeinto
contact with you or your clothing.
• Neveroperatethecompressor
with guards or covers which
are damaged or removed.
• Keepyourhair,clothing,and
gloves away from moving parts.
Looseclothes,jewelry,orlonghair
can be caught in moving parts.
• Airventsmaycovermovingparts
and should be avoided as well.
• Attemptingtooperatecompressor
with damaged or missing parts or
attempting to repair compressor
with protective shrouds removed
can expose you to moving parts
andcanresultinseriousinjury.
• Anyrepairsrequiredonthisproduct
should be performed by authorized
service center personnel.
